Accepting Applications for the positions of Comptroller and Assistant Director of Public Works
The City of Charleston is a statutory City Manager Form of Government where the City Manager is appointed by the Mayor and City Council. The Comptroller serves on the City’s Executive Staff and reports directly to the City Manager. The current Comptroller is leaving the City after 17 years of exemplary service to the City. The City is in strong financial condition, experiencing significant sales tax revenue increases over the past three fiscal years, currently maintains an A+ Bond Rating, and is well below the statutory general obligation debt limit.
The Comptroller serves as the City Treasurer and oversees nine funds within an approximate $37,000,000 annual budget and has daily oversight of three full-time employees. The Comptroller inspects the collection of salaries, invoices, unpaid bills, and asset management for the City.

The City of Charleston, Illinois is seeking a team-oriented, flexible, and likable public works professional who desires to serve as an Assistant Public Works Director and train under the current Public Works Director to succeed him in the next few years.
The City of Charleston is a statutory City Manager Form of Government where the City Manager is appointed by the Mayor and City Council. The Assistant Public Works Director assists with the oversight of a full-service Public Works Department and reports directly to the Director of Public Works. The current Assistant Director of Public Works is leaving the City after decades of municipal service. The Public Works Department includes 38 team members. The Department includes Utilities, Engineering, Streets, Wastewater Treatment Plant, and the Water Treatment Plant.
The City described success for the next Assistant Public Works Director as a manager who can keep projects under budget and on schedule. A leader who invests in their team by advocating for professional development and one who fosters a great work environment.
